Property Amenities
President Motor Inn features an outdoor pool and a rooftop terrace. The property has a front desk available during limited hours. Limited onsite parking is available on a first-come, first-served basis (surcharge).
Rooms
President Motor Inn offers 42 accommodations, which are accessible via exterior corridors and feature complimentary toiletries and blackout drapes/curtains. Rooms open to balconies. Televisions come with cable channels. Bathrooms include shower/tub combinations. Housekeeping is provided daily.

Niagara Falls, Ontario, Canada: Big attractions accompany the big falls experience in Canada. Fallsview Indoor Water Park, one of the continents largest, sits at the foot of the Rainbow Bridge. Nearby, MarineLand Canada features killer and beluga whales. Gamblers can chose between Casino Niagara and Fallsview Casino Resort, one of Canadas largest. On a clear day, visitors can see Toronto atop the 520-foot Skylon Tower.
